Job description
Responsibilites:
  • Design, configure, and maintain solutions across various OneTrust modules (e.g., Privacy Management, Data Mapping, Assessments, Risk Management, Incident Management, Regulatory Intelligence, Vendor Risk).
  • Build and optimize workflows, questionnaires, rules, automation, templates, dashboards, and integrations within the OneTrust admin console.
  • Translate business, legal, and regulatory requirements (e.g., GDPR, risk and compliance frameworks) into technical OneTrust configurations.
  • Develop and maintain system documentation, configuration standards, and architecture diagrams.
  • Work closely with legal, privacy, compliance, risk, and security teams to understand requirements and recommend optimal OneTrust solutions.
  • Act as the technical expert during workshops, discussions, and requirement-gathering sessions.
  • Collaborate with IT teams to integrate OneTrust with internal and external systems (APIs, SSO, data sources).
  • Monitor and optimize OneTrust performance, workflows, and data quality.
  • Stay up to date with OneTrust releases and industry best practices and assess their applicability.
Requirements:
  • 3–4+ years of hands‑on technical experience working with the OneTrust platform, specifically in configuration and administration, not only functional understanding.
  • Demonstrated ability to independently configure and deploy solutions in OneTrust (admin console, workflows, automation, API integrations, custom logic).
  • Strong understanding of GDPR, privacy governance, data protection, and/or risk management frameworks.
  • Solid technical background, preferably in IT, information systems, or software engineering.
  • Experience working with legal, privacy, risk, or compliance teams and translating requirements into technical solutions.
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ills.
  • Excellent English communication skills (written and verbal).
